This role requires interacting and influencing internal and external stakeholders to ensure project success. The Program Manager will follow and document all CMS and MassHealth risk related activites and ensure the company is positioned to meet any new requirements; as well as, develop ideas that enhances our company's competitive position for risk adjustment.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
• Lead all internal and external risk adjusted projects
• Follows all CMS calls and presentations to ensure compliance and identify new ideas and strategies for improving risk adjustment
• Manages all vendor relationships and helps negotiate any new or existing contracts
• Develop and present complex analytics that communicate ongoing financial performance from internally custom built and externally vendor built sources.
• Communicate directly with C Suite as needed for risk adjustment analytics.
• Participate in all audits
• Develops strategies for provider training, education and medical management
• Evaluates data quality of internal and external datasets

EXPERIENCE

Required:
• 5 plus years of experience in healthcare reporting of healthcare data analysis using SQL and/or SAS
• Advanced Excel
• 2 plus years leading complex projects
• Previous experience presenting analytics to executive level
• Knowledge of HHS Commercial Risk Adjustment and ACA
• Knowledge of MassHealth risk adjustment and DxCG
Preferred/Desired:
• Previous experience with CMS risk adjustment audits (RADV)
